What Are Soffits?
Soffits are the horizontal panels located beneath the overhang of a roof eave. They serve both practical and visual purposes, consisting of:
- Ventilation: Soffits often include vents that permit air flow into the attic, preventing moisture accumulation and promoting air circulation.
- Visual appeals: They supply a finished aim to the roofline and can boost the general design of a home.
- Protection: Soffits shield the rafters and eaves from the components, reducing the risk of water damage and pest infiltration.
Kinds of Soffits
Soffits can be found in numerous materials and styles. Comprehending these choices is vital when selecting a soffit installer. Here's a breakdown of the most common soffit types:
Type
Product
Functions
Vinyl
PVC
Low upkeep, weather-resistant, and flexible in color.
Aluminum
Metal
Resilient, lightweight, and available in numerous surfaces.
Wood
Timber
Conventional appearance, however needs routine maintenance to avoid rot.
Fiber Cement
Cement-based
Resistant to moisture and bugs, suitable for harsh climates.

The Installation Process
Comprehending the installation process can assist house owners interact efficiently with soffit installers. Here's a detailed guide to what to anticipate:
Initial Assessment
- The installer examines the existing soffit and determines any problems that require dealing with, such as damage or insufficient ventilation.
Material Selection
- House owners discuss their preferences relating to product and design, taking into factor to consider environment, upkeep, and looks.
Preparation
- The location is prepared by eliminating any old soffits and resolving any structural concerns. This might consist of repairing fascia boards or sealing spaces.
Setup
- New soffit panels are cut to size, fitted, and safely installed. Proper venting is ensured, if suitable.
Ending up Touches
- Any essential trim work is completed, and the area is tidied up, leaving the site cool and prepared for evaluation.
Elements Affecting Cost
The cost of soffit setup can differ based on a number of factors. Understanding these can help house owners spending plan successfully:
Factor
Description
Material Type
Vinyl, aluminum, wood, or fiber cement.
Home Size
Bigger homes need more materials and labor.
Damage Repair
Additional expenses may arise from structural repair work before setup.
Geographic Location
Costs can differ by region based upon labor rates and material accessibility.
